Showing newbie Birmingham clubs how it is done, the infamous Q Club returns with its biggest bash yet and ready for fresh student spirits to roam its party halls this coming October. A converted church that has seen globally sought after DJ faces and boasts over 25 rooms, Q Club have chosen 2013 as the year that they invite not one, but all four Birmingham universities for a night of party antics.

Whilst we can count only, say, 100 heads in this picture, imagine Q Club hosting 4,900 more at this years biggest student night in Birmingham on October 22nd.

Utilising over 14 of Q Club's party rooms this October 22nd, Cool It Events have organised an almighty student extravaganza in the city where no genre or party feature has been left unturned. From music themed rooms and fairground rides to food stalls and chill out zones, Student Fest 2013 really have thought of everything; making this possibly and most likely one of the biggest student nights that Brum has ever seen with over 4000 students from BCU, UOB, Aston and UCB invited along for the party ride. Here are just a small (and we mean small) selection of arena's on offer at this years Student Fest in Q Club:

  • Wild Wild West feat. A Rodeo Bull
  • The Dungeon feat. fire breathers and angle grinders
  • G.L.O.W.R.A.V.E. feat. 30 UV cannons and face paint stations
  • Market Street feat. a sweet shop, coconut shy and photo stall
